In the case of Vidyard content, we use a global CDN to cache and deliver content more quickly so that we can better ensure smooth performance and push important updates in a more timely manner.
While local caching may potentially decrease load times by a small amount, it could also produce issues if changes were made to the player after content was cached since an older version of the script may be running on the browser.
That being said, our team are always looking to streamline the playback and loading experience to help speed up performance in general.
If you do wish to defer overall script loads on the page, we do have some sample scripts which can be used to load a player on demand after the initial page load which may help with your situation.
